About Our Organisation

At For the Love of Dogs Academy (FTLDA), we’re a startup charity and social enterprise on a mission to connect people through the incredible human-animal bond. Our programs focus on social inclusion, skill-building, and employment, creating life-changing opportunities for people with disabilities while celebrating the joy dogs bring to our lives.

This event is part of our inaugural celebration and aligns with International Day of People with Disability. Featuring a professional photoshoot with dogs, a BBQ, a photo booth, and more, it’s all about fostering community, connection, and fun.
